History & Origin
Jadarius is a modern coinage joining the Ja- prefix to Darius — from Old Persian Daryavush, 'possessor, holder of the good; wealthy' (routes layered, which we flag). It has no single fixed root; the grand sound carries it.
It registers thinly in records. Rare, possessor-of-the-good in echo, and grand.
